Customizing Your Soup

One of the best things about this creamy squash soup is its versatility. Feel free to add your favorite herbs or spices to elevate the flavor. A sprinkle of fresh thyme or rosemary can bring an aromatic twist, while a dash of cayenne pepper adds a subtle kick. Experimenting with different ingredients can lead to delightful variations, making this recipe your own.

For those looking to enhance the nutritional value further, consider adding cooked lentils or chickpeas into the mix. Not only will this boost the protein content, but it will also add a pleasant texture to the soup. Additionally, topping the soup with roasted pumpkin seeds or croutons can provide a delightful crunch, making each bite an exciting experience.

Ingredients

Gather these fresh ingredients to create your creamy squash soup:

Ingredients

  • 1 medium butternut squash, peeled and diced
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 1 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Olive oil for sautéing

Make sure to have these ingredients ready before you start cooking!

Instructions

Follow these simple steps to prepare your creamy squash soup:

Sauté the Vegetables

In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ic, sautéing until the onion is translucent.

Cook the Squash

Add the diced butternut squash to the pot and stir. Pour in the vegetable broth, bring to a boil, then reduce the heat and simmer for about 20 minutes, or until the squash is tender.

Blend the Soup

Using an immersion blender or a regular blender, puree the soup until smooth. If using a regular blender, be cautious with hot liquids.

Add Cream and Seasoning

Stir in the heavy cream and ground nutmeg.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Heat through before serving.

Your creamy squash soup is now ready to be enjoyed!

Nutritional Benefits

Butternut squash is not only delicious but also packed with nutrients. It's an excellent source of vitamin A, which is vital for maintaining healthy vision and immune function. Additionally, its high fiber content aids digestion and promotes a feeling of fullness, making this soup a satisfying choice for any meal.

The heavy cream in this recipe adds richness and a luxurious mouthfeel, but for those looking to lighten it up, you can substitute with coconut milk or a plant-based cream. This not only reduces the calorie count but also makes the soup suitable for vegan diets without sacrificing flavor.

Storage and Reheating

If you have leftovers, this creamy squash soup stores beautifully in the refrigerator for up to five days. Simply place it in an airtight container and reheat on the stovetop or in the microwave until warmed through. The flavors will continue to develop, making it even more delicious the next day.

For longer storage, consider freezing the soup. It can be stored in freezer-safe containers for up to three months. To thaw, simply transfer to the refrigerator overnight before reheating. Remember to stir well after thawing, as the texture may change slightly upon freezing.
